Mass timber is quickly becoming a solution as the number of public institutions and private developers pledging to attain net-zero carbon emissions increases. With public and private support for this renewable resource, experts believe mass timber could challenge steel and concrete as favored construction materials.

Stewardship of the planet: There is an increasing emphasis on reducing energy consumption and minimizing the waste of natural resources, such as water. One effective way to achieve this is by using thermal mass, which refers to a material’s ability to absorb, store, and release heat energy.
